History of Barcelos

Barcelos, a charming town in the northern region of Portugal, boasts a rich history that dates back to Roman times. The town's strategic location along the Cávado River made it a vital settlement during the Roman Empire, with remnants of its ancient past still visible today. Barcelos flourished significantly during the Middle Ages, becoming an important center for trade and crafts.

In the 12th century, Barcelos gained prominence when it was granted a charter by King Afonso I, Portugal's first monarch. This period saw the construction of the impressive Barcelos Castle, which served as the residence of the Counts of Barcelos. The town's medieval charm is still evident in its narrow streets and historical architecture.

Barcelos is also famously linked to the legend of the Rooster of Barcelos, a tale of faith and justice that has become a national symbol of Portugal. The weekly open-air market, one of the oldest and largest in Portugal, has been a tradition since medieval times and continues to draw visitors from near and far.

Local culture and customs in Barcelos

Barcelos, a charming town in northern Portugal, is deeply rooted in tradition and folklore. One of the most iconic symbols of Barcelos is the Galo de Barcelos (Rooster of Barcelos), a colorful ceramic rooster that signifies good luck and is linked to a local legend about justice and faith. The town is also renowned for its vibrant weekly market, held every Thursday. This market is one of the largest and oldest in Portugal, offering a variety of local produce, handicrafts, and traditional ceramics.

Visitors should take the time to appreciate the local craftsmanship, particularly the intricate embroidery and pottery that are central to the town's cultural identity. Additionally, Barcelos is known for its festivals, especially the Festa das Cruzes (Festival of the Crosses) in May, which is a blend of religious processions, music, and fireworks. Participating in these events provides an authentic glimpse into the local way of life.

When it comes to social etiquette, politeness is key. Greeting locals with a simple 'Bom dia' (Good day) or 'Boa tarde' (Good afternoon) is appreciated. Dining customs often include sharing dishes and enjoying leisurely meals, so take your time to savor the flavors and engage in conversation. Currency information for travelers in Barcelos

Travelers in Barcelos, Portugal will use the Euro (€) as the local currency. It's advisable to carry a mix of cash and cards, as smaller establishments, local markets, and some restaurants may prefer cash payments. ATMs are widely available throughout Barcelos and offer a convenient way to withdraw Euros, but be mindful of potential international transaction fees from your bank.

Credit and debit cards, particularly Visa and Mastercard, are widely accepted in hotels, larger restaurants, and retail stores. However, it's always a good idea to have some cash on hand for smaller purchases or in case a card isn't accepted. When budgeting, consider that prices in Barcelos might be lower than in larger Portuguese cities, allowing you to enjoy more for less. Best time to visit Barcelos

The best time to explore Barcelos is during the spring months of April to June and the early autumn period of September to October. During these seasons, the weather is pleasantly mild, with daytime temperatures ranging from 15°C to 25°C (59°F to 77°F), making it ideal for outdoor activities and sightseeing. Summer months from July to August can be quite warm, with temperatures often exceeding 30°C (86°F), which might be uncomfortable for some travelers and result in higher crowd levels.

One of the highlights of visiting Barcelos in spring is the Festa das Cruzes (Festival of the Crosses), held at the end of April and early May. This vibrant festival includes parades, fireworks, and local crafts, offering a unique cultural experience for tourists.

Early autumn is another favorable time due to the warm yet comfortable temperatures and thinner crowds. This season is perfect for leisurely exploring the city's historic sites and enjoying the serene beauty of the surrounding countryside.

Weather in Barcelos

Barcelos, located in the northwest of Portugal, experiences a temperate maritime climate, influenced by its proximity to the Atlantic Ocean. The city enjoys mild winters and warm summers, making it an attractive destination year-round. Winter temperatures typically range from 5°C to 15°C (41°F to 59°F), with occasional rainfall, which is heaviest between November and February.

Spring and autumn offer pleasant weather, with temperatures averaging between 10°C and 20°C (50°F to 68°F), and are considered ideal seasons to visit due to the moderate climate and lower chances of rain. Summer in Barcelos is warm and dry, with temperatures often reaching between 20°C and 30°C (68°F to 86°F) in July and August.

Travelers should note that while summer days are generally sunny and dry, occasional heatwaves can push temperatures higher. Considering the seasonal variations, it's advisable to pack layers and waterproof clothing if visiting during the wetter months, and lighter, breathable fabrics for the warmer summer days.

Local tip for visiting Barcelos

For an authentic experience in Barcelos, make sure to visit the Barrocal area on a Thursday morning. This is when the weekly market, Feira de Barcelos, comes to life. Known as one of the largest and most traditional markets in Portugal, it offers a unique opportunity to mingle with locals and discover regional products, crafts, and delicacies you won't find elsewhere. An insider tip: arrive early, around 8 AM, to avoid the crowds and get the best picks of fresh produce and handmade goods. Transportation in Barcelos

Barcelos offers a variety of transportation options to help you explore the city and surrounding areas with ease. The city's public transit system includes buses that connect key points of interest and neighboring towns, providing an efficient and affordable way to get around. For a more personalized travel experience, taxis are readily available and can be hailed on the street or booked via phone. Rental cars are another convenient option, especially if you plan to explore the scenic countryside and nearby attractions at your own pace.

One unique local transportation experience in Barcelos is the 'Comboio Turístico,' a charming tourist train that runs through the city, offering a relaxed and scenic way to see the main sights.
